What to check before for buildings with low rent increases near Rector St station in NYC

  • Use this page as a shortlist: open each building page to check current availability, rent-related history notes, and what tenants report about year-to-year changes.
  • Before signing, confirm the full monthly cost (rent plus any required fees, deposits, utilities responsibilities, and parking/storage if applicable).
  • Ask the building directly how rent increases are applied for your unit type and lease term, and whether any recent changes affect timing or amount.
  • Review screening requirements and any renewal terms in writing, especially if your lease will start mid-year or align with a renewal window.
